GROVE MALL REDEVELOPMENT - LIBRARY ISSUES
The consensus of the Committee was as follows:
• to limit the Wellington Avenue access drive to the Library
to one-way traffic in the easterly direction; and
• to give the Library preferred reservation standing for usage
of the Village Green subject to written request 21 days in
advance of the date of the event.

The Committee discussed various aspects regarding the
Dominick's facility, including facade design, lighting plan, and
traffic signals. Upon further discussion, the consensus of the
Committee was as follows:
• to schedule a Committee of the Whole meeting for Thursday,
March 13, at 6:00 p.m. , in the.Chernick Conference Room;
• to approve the Hamilton Partner site plan and redevelopment
agreement at the March 11, 1997 Village Board meeting,
subject to Village Board approval of Dominick's revised
lighting plan and facade design on March 13; and
• to accept Dominick's site plan option #IB; and
• to examine if warrants exist to install a traffic signal at
Arlington Heights Road and Lonsdale approximately 3 months
after the opening of the Dominick's facility. If so, the
Village will provide 50a of the cost to install the traffic
signal .
